编程中的语法错误指什么

worktile 其他 22

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程中的语法错误是指程序中存在的不符合编程语言规定的语法规则的错误。编程语言有自己的语法规则,程序员需要按照这些规则编写代码。如果代码中违反了语法规则,编译器或解释器将无法正确解析代码,导致程序无法编译或运行。

    语法错误可以包括以下几种类型:

    1. 关键词错误:在编程语言中,有一些关键词是保留的,不能作为变量名或函数名使用。如果将这些关键词错误地用作标识符,就会发生语法错误。

    2. 标点符号错误:在编程语言中,标点符号的使用是有规定的,例如括号、分号、逗号等。如果标点符号的使用不正确,就会发生语法错误。

    3. 变量命名错误:变量名的命名规则是由编程语言规定的,例如不能以数字开头,不能包含特殊字符等。如果变量名不符合命名规则,就会发生语法错误。

    4. 函数调用错误:在调用函数时,需要按照函数的定义和规定传入正确的参数。如果参数的数量或类型不符合规定,就会发生语法错误。

    5. 缩进错误:对于使用缩进来表示代码块的编程语言,如Python,缩进的使用是非常重要的。如果缩进不正确,就会发生语法错误。

    编程中的语法错误是最常见的错误之一,但也是最容易被发现和修复的错误。编程人员可以通过阅读错误提示或使用调试工具来定位语法错误的位置,并进行修复。修复语法错误后,程序才能正常编译和运行。因此,编程人员需要在编写代码时严格遵守编程语言的语法规则,以避免语法错误的发生。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程中的语法错误是指程序中违反编程语言规则的错误。编程语言有着自己的语法规则,这些规则定义了如何正确地组织和书写代码。当程序违反了这些规则,编译器或解释器无法正确理解代码的意思,就会报告语法错误。

    以下是关于编程中常见的语法错误的一些例子:

    1. 拼写错误:在编程中,拼写错误可能是最常见的语法错误之一。如果程序中的关键字、变量名或函数名的拼写有误,编译器或解释器将无法识别这些标识符,从而报告拼写错误。

    2. 缺少分号:在许多编程语言中,分号被用作语句的结束符号。如果忘记在语句的末尾加上分号,编译器或解释器将无法正确识别语句的结束,从而导致语法错误。

    3. 括号不匹配:在编程中,括号的使用非常重要,它们用于标识代码块、函数参数和条件语句等。如果括号的数量或位置不正确,编译器或解释器将无法正确解析代码,从而引发语法错误。

    4. 缩进错误:在使用一些编程语言时,代码的缩进是强制性的。如果代码的缩进不正确,编译器或解释器将无法正确理解代码的结构,从而导致语法错误。

    5. 引号不匹配:在编程中,引号用于表示字符串或字符。如果引号的数量或位置不匹配,编译器或解释器将无法正确识别字符串的边界,从而引发语法错误。

    通过仔细检查和调试代码,可以找出并修复这些语法错误。编程工具和IDE(集成开发环境)通常会提供语法错误的提示和自动纠正功能,帮助程序员尽早发现和纠正这些错误。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,语法错误是指程序中存在不符合编程语言规则的代码。编程语言有其特定的语法规则,程序员必须按照这些规则编写代码,以确保代码能够被编译器或解释器正确理解和执行。

    语法错误是最常见的编程错误之一,它们通常由于以下原因引起:

    1. 拼写错误:当程序员错误地输入一个关键字、函数名或变量名时,编译器将无法识别这个标识符,从而产生语法错误。

    2. 缺少分号:在大多数编程语言中,分号用于表示语句的结束。如果程序员忘记在语句末尾添加分号,编译器将无法正确解析代码,从而产生语法错误。

    3. 括号不匹配:在编程中,括号用于表示代码块的起始和结束。如果程序员忘记在代码块中正确地匹配括号,编译器将无法正确解析代码,从而产生语法错误。

    4. 缩进错误:在一些编程语言中,缩进是强制性的,用于表示代码块的层次结构。如果程序员没有正确缩进代码,或者缩进不一致,编译器将无法正确解析代码,从而产生语法错误。

    5. 错误的语句顺序:有些编程语言要求代码按照特定的顺序编写,例如先定义变量再使用变量。如果程序员违反了这些规则,编译器将无法正确解析代码,从而产生语法错误。

    当编译器或解释器检测到语法错误时,它们通常会给出一条错误消息,指示错误的位置和原因。程序员可以根据错误消息来定位和修复语法错误。

    为了避免语法错误,程序员应该熟悉所使用的编程语言的语法规则,并且在编写代码时遵循这些规则。此外,使用集成开发环境(IDE)可以帮助程序员在编写代码时及时发现并纠正语法错误。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部